NIGHT CLUB :

A night club is a venue where people gather to socialize, dance, and enjoy music and drinks during late hours. It is a popular form of entertainment and a key part of the nightlife scene in many cities.

NIGHT CLUB Service Costs :

The cost of a night club in South African rands can vary depending on the location, popularity, and type of services offered. Generally, the cost of admission can range from R50 to R200, and drinks can cost anywhere from R30 to R150 each.

How to Select NIGHT CLUB :

– Location is an important factor to consider when choosing a night club. Look for a club that is easily accessible and in a safe area.
– Consider the type of music played at the club. Choose a night club that offers music genres that you enjoy.
– Look into the dress code policy of the club. Make sure you follow the dress code to avoid any issues at the entrance.
– Research the age limit of the club. Some clubs have strict age restrictions and require you to show a valid ID.
– Check the club’s website or social media pages for upcoming events and special promotions.
– Read reviews from previous customers to get an idea of the overall atmosphere and customer service.
– Consider the pricing of drinks and admission fees. Make sure it fits within your budget.
– Look at the crowd that usually attends the club. Choose a night club that attracts a diverse and friendly crowd.
– Look into the club’s safety measures such as security staff and fire exits.
– Trust your gut instinct and choose a club that you feel comfortable and safe in.

FAQs About NIGHT CLUB :

Q: Can I enter a night club if I am under 18?

A: No, most night clubs have a minimum age requirement of 18 for entry.

Q: Do all night clubs have a dress code?

A: Yes, most night clubs have a dress code policy. It is best to check with the club beforehand to avoid any issues at the entrance.

Q: Do I need to make a reservation before going to a night club?

A: It depends on the popularity of the club and the event. It is recommended to reserve a spot for special events or busy nights.

Q: Can I bring my own alcohol to a night club?

A: No, outside alcohol is not allowed in most night clubs.

Q: Are there any discounts for admission fees?

A: Some clubs may offer discounts for early bird tickets or group bookings. It is best to check with the club beforehand.

Q: Are there any age restrictions for night clubs?

A: Yes, most night clubs have a minimum age requirement of 18 for entry.

Q: Can I purchase tickets at the door?

A: Yes, most night clubs allow you to purchase tickets at the door. However, pre-purchasing tickets is recommended for popular events.

Q: Can I leave the club and come back later?

A: It depends on the club’s policy. Some may allow re-entry with a handstamp, while others may not.

Q: Are there any food options at a night club?

A: Some night clubs may have a kitchen or offer light snacks, but it is not common. It is best to eat beforehand or grab a bite after leaving the club.

Q: Can I pay with a credit or debit card at a night club?

A: Most night clubs accept card payments, but it is best to bring cash as some clubs may have a minimum spend for card payments.

Q: Can I smoke inside a night club?

A: No, smoking indoors is not allowed in South Africa as per the law. Most night clubs have designated outdoor smoking areas.
